Timeslot

Definition: A designated period of time, typically used for scheduling or broadcasting specific activities, events, or programs.

Examples:

  • TV networks divide their programming into timeslots, such as morning, prime time, and late night.
  • Our team has booked a two-hour timeslot for our meeting in the conference room.
  • The radio station secured an exclusive timeslot to interview the famous author.
